People’s Arts Collective and Friends, in partnership with the Everybody’s Reading Festival presents: Walls

Saturday 8 October

Walls is on the theme of seeking asylum, linking to the works of Margarethe Klopfleich in the Museum bringing together arts around the lives people leave behind, the cultures that they bring with them, and journeys they have made.

Time:  10am – 12.30pm and 1pm – 4pm
